Boston Scientific Offers Hospitals Free-Stent Incentive
17th Oct 2005, 19:01 GMT
Battling to keep its share of one of the world's largest medical-device market, Boston Scientific said yesterday that it would provide a free new Taxus coronary stent to any hospital treating a patient whose artery clogs around the device.
